You may obtain a copy of the License at + * + * http://www.apache.org/licenses/LICENSE-2.0 + * + * Unless required by applicable law or agreed to in writing, software + * distributed under the License is distributed on an "AS IS" BASIS, + * WITHOUT WARRANTIES OR CONDITIONS OF ANY KIND, either express or implied. + * See the License for the specific language governing permissions and + * limitations under the License. + */ +package org.apache.lucene.analysis.en; + +import java.io.IOException; +import java.util.Map; +import org.apache.lucene.analysis.CharArraySet; +import org.apache.lucene.analysis.TokenFilterFactory; +import org.apache.lucene.analysis.WordlistLoader; +import org.apache.lucene.util.ResourceLoader; +import org.apache.lucene.util.ResourceLoaderAware; + +/** + * Abstract parent class for analysis factories that accept a stopwords file as input. + * + * <p>Concrete implementations can leverage the following input attributes. All attributes are + * optional: + * + * <ul> + * <li><code>ignoreCase</code> defaults to <code>false</code> + * <li><code>words</code> should be the name of a stopwords file to parse, if not specified the + * factory will use the value provided by {@link #createDefaultWords()} implementation in + * concrete subclass. + * <li><code>format</code> defines how the <code>words</code> file will be parsed, and defaults to + * <code>wordset</code>. If <code>words</code> is not specified, then <code>format</code> must + * not be specified. + * </ul> + * + * <p>The valid values for the <code>format</code> option are: + * + * <ul> + * <li><code>wordset</code> - This is the default format, which supports one word per line + * (including any intra-word whitespace) and allows whole line comments beginning with the "#" + * character. Blank lines are ignored. See {@link WordlistLoader#getLines + * WordlistLoader.getLines} for details. + * <li><code>snowball</code> - This format allows for multiple words specified on each line, and + * trailing comments may be specified using the vertical line ("|"). Blank lines are + * ignored.
